Transaction cdba793bfece75a743e7670c0294040cc94df782d881f9bd485e1188edaad357
1 Input
2 Outputs
- cdba793bfece75a743e7670c0294040cc94df782d881f9bd485e1188edaad357:0
- cdba793bfece75a743e7670c0294040cc94df782d881f9bd485e1188edaad357:1
value 403016
address 1HuDEncvTtBDTXVUdKJxEUqBxRezTuVU8h
value 22484000
address 3NTmfTo4q4LjhqWzgEYzY9nAsCkSVWAJiL